Aircraft noise measurement<br />

FBB creates transparency<br />

Stationary measuring points<br />

Airports are obligated by the legislator<br />

to operate measuring points on the<br />

airport and in its surrounding area for<br />

documentation of the aircraft noise.<br />

Flughafen Berlin Brandenburg GmbH<br />

has for this purpose installed a total of<br />

31 stationary measuring points in the<br />

surrounding area of Schönefeld and<br />

Tegel Airports (status 31 December<br />

<strong>2019</strong>). The measuring results are transmitted<br />

monthly to the responsible authorities<br />

and the flight noise<br />

commissions and are published in the<br />

Internet.<br />

Sites<br />

The locations for the stationary measuring<br />

points are stipulated by consultation<br />

with the aircraft noise commissions, in<br />

which the neighbouring municipalities<br />

and districts are represented. In principle,<br />

measuring points are placed along<br />

approach and departure routes and in<br />

residential areas affected by aircraft<br />

noise. In the selection of the locations,<br />

other sources of noise are avoided as<br />

they can lead to a falsification of the<br />

results. The measurement data are retrieved<br />

continuously from the measuring<br />

points and automatically allocated to<br />

the flight movements based on the radar<br />

data of the German Air Traffic Control<br />

Services. Noise events not caused by the<br />

air traffic are removed manually from<br />

the statistics. Weather data is included in<br />

order to avoid a falsification of the measurement<br />

results, for example by strong<br />

wind. Finally, the distribution of the<br />

individual and permanent noise levels<br />

as well as further acoustic key data are<br />

calculated. Through this form of aircraft<br />

noise monitoring, FBB is in the<br />

position to provide information about<br />

the noise emissions of each flight<br />

movement and reliably and continuously<br />

document the development of<br />

the aircraft noise situation. The data is in<br />

particular used for the calculation of the<br />

noise-related take-off and landing fees as<br />

well as for the processing of complaints.<br />
